How to Make Street Corn Chicken Rice Bowls Recipe

Step 1: Season and Cook the Chicken

Start by tossing the diced chicken breasts with olive oil and all the vibrant spices—chili powder, smoked paprika, garlic powder, cumin, kosher salt, and black pepper. This seasoning mix packs a flavorful punch, so don’t be shy! Heat a skillet or grill pan over medium-high heat, then cook the chicken for 6 to 8 minutes until it’s nicely browned on the outside and cooked through. This step ensures your chicken will be tender and full of smoky, spicy flavor, serving as the hearty base for your bowls.

Step 2: Prepare the Street Corn Mixture

While your chicken is cooking, combine the corn kernels with mayonnaise, sour cream, crumbled cotija cheese, freshly squeezed lime juice, chili powder, and chopped cilantro in a bowl. This creamy, tangy mix brings all the classic elements of Mexican street corn to life. Using grilled corn will deepen the smoky flavor, but fresh or frozen corn works beautifully as well. Stir it all together until every kernel is beautifully coated.

Step 3: Assemble the Bowls

Divide the cooked white or cilantro-lime rice evenly among four bowls. Then layer on the juicy, spiced chicken, followed by generous spoonfuls of the luscious street corn mixture. Top each bowl with sliced avocado and diced cherry tomatoes for an extra burst of freshness and creaminess. Finally, garnish with fresh cilantro and include lime wedges for squeezing, adding brightness exactly when you want it.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Street Corn Chicken Rice Bowls Recipe leftovers can be stored in airtight containers in the fridge for up to 3 days. Keep avocado slices separate if possible to prevent browning. When you’re ready to eat, just reassemble the bowl with fresh garnishes for a meal that tastes freshly made.

Freezing

The chicken and rice components freeze well individually but it’s best to avoid freezing the avocado, tomatos, and creamy street corn mix to maintain their texture. Freeze the chicken and rice in separate containers for up to 2 months, thaw overnight in the fridge, then freshly prepare the toppings before serving.

Reheating

To reheat, warm the chicken and rice gently in a skillet or microwave until heated through. Add the street corn mixture and fresh toppings after reheating for the best texture and flavor combination. A quick fresh squeeze of lime can revive all the bright flavors before digging in.

FAQs

Can I use frozen corn for this recipe?

Absolutely! Frozen corn is a convenient and tasty option that works perfectly in the street corn mixture. Just thaw it before mixing to avoid watering down the other ingredients.

What if I don’t have cotija cheese?

You can substitute crumbled queso fresco or even feta cheese if cotija is not available. Each will lend a salty, tangy element that enhances the creamy street corn topping.

Is this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, the Street Corn Chicken Rice Bowls Recipe is naturally gluten-free when using gluten-free mayonnaise and seasonings. It’s a great choice for those watching their gluten intake.

Can I make this recipe vegan or vegetarian?

To make a vegan or vegetarian version, replace the chicken with grilled tofu or roasted vegetables and use vegan mayonnaise and sour cream alternatives. The rest of the ingredients keep the vibrant flavors intact.

How spicy is this dish?

This recipe has a mild to moderate spice level thanks to the chili powder and paprika. You can easily adjust the heat by increasing the chili powder or adding chopped jalapeños for more kick.

Ingredients

For the Chicken

  • lbs boneless, skinless chicken breasts, diced
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p chili powder
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• ½ tsp ground cumin
  • 1 tsp kosher sal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per

Street Corn

  • 3 cups corn kernels (fresh, frozen, or grilled)
  • ⅓ cup mayonnaise
  • ¼ cup sour cream
  • ½ cup crumbled cotija cheese
  • Juice of 1 lime
  • 1 tsp chili powder
  • 2 tbsp chopped cilantro

Bowls

  • 4 cups cooked white or cilantro-lime rice
  • 1 avocado, sliced
  • ½ cup diced cherry tomatoes
  • Fresh cilantro
  • Lime wedges


Instructions

  1. Season the Chicken: Toss the diced chicken with olive oil, chili powder, smoked paprika, garlic powder, ground cumin, kosher salt, and black pepper until evenly coated.
  2. Cook the Chicken: Heat a skillet or grill pan over medium-high heat and cook the seasoned chicken for 6–8 minutes, stirring occasionally, until browned and fully cooked through.
  3. Prepare the Street Corn Mixture: In a bowl, combine the corn kernels with mayonnaise, sour cream, crumbled cotija cheese, lime juice, chili powder, and chopped cilantro, mixing thoroughly to create a creamy, flavorful street corn salad.
  4. Assemble the Bowls: Divide the cooked white or cilantro-lime rice evenly among four serving bowls.
  5. Add Toppings: Top each rice base with the cooked chicken, a generous scoop of the street corn mixture, sliced avocado, and diced cherry tomatoes.
  6. Garnish and Serve: Garnish the bowls with fresh cilantro leaves and serve with lime wedges on the side for an added burst of brightness.

Notes

  • Grilled corn adds the best smoky flavor to the dish.
  • Substitute queso fresco for cotija cheese if unavailable.
  • Add black beans or pickled onions for extra texture and flavor.
